Baby Ruth: From Chaos to Clarity in AA
Episode Overview
- The speaker reflects on their privileged yet chaotic upbringing and the early signs of alcoholism.
- Struggles with denial, failed treatments, and the realization of powerlessness over alcohol consumption.
- The speaker's discovery of Alcoholics Anonymous and the initial scepticism towards the program's principles.
- Transformation through group therapy, support from AA members, and the importance of admitting powerlessness.
- The ongoing journey of self-realization, the need for continuous support, and the speaker's gratitude for the AA community.

Ever wondered how someone can turn their life around after hitting rock bottom? In this episode of Recovery Radio Network, an anonymous speaker, known as Baby Ruth, shares her raw and moving story. She takes us through her privileged yet chaotic upbringing, her struggles with denial and despair, and the incredible transformation she experienced through Alcoholics Anonymous (AA). Baby Ruth's journey is filled with moments of vulnerability, strength, and self-discovery.
Her candid reflections on the power of AA's community and the steps she took towards lasting sobriety offer a compelling look at the resilience of the human spirit.
